What is a fix & flip hard money loan and why is it ideal for Ward, AR?

Fix & flip hard money loans are asset-based loans funded by private investors, not traditional banks. They are ideal for the dynamic Ward, AR market because they offer speed, flexibility, and fewer hurdles than conventional financing, making them perfect for quickly acquiring, renovating, and selling residential properties where time is critical to maximize profits.

Do you require an appraisal for Ward, AR properties?

To expedite the process, we often utilize BPOs (Broker's Price Opinions) or conduct our own internal valuations based on recent comparable sales and our extensive experience in the Ward, AR real estate market, rather than waiting for a full, traditional appraisal. This helps us close faster and get you funded for your fix & flip project without delay.
